For more than 20 years, the community radio station RLF (formerly Loire FM) Loire FM has been broadcasting in Saint-Étienne. A salaried employee and more than 70 volunteers are at the service of the station. You can follow local, national and international news during seven daily broadcasts, from 4am to 10pm. Culture, sport, association news and debates are widely relayed on the station. Interviews with local authors, politics and city council meetings are systematically broadcast in their entirety. RLF is equipped with a mobile studio and can thus travel to different locations to make broadcasts outside its premises.

Created in 1981, this free radio station broadcasts in the Drôme and Ardèche regions, from Valence to Nyons via the Diois, and from Aubenas to Privas, and aims - with some success - to be the local and musical substitute for the big national stations. Newscasts every hour from 7am to 8pm, with quality local and regional news, interviews and commentary from the region's key players. We also like the news releases from associations, providing information on festivities, conferences, sporting events and more...

In 1982, Lyon was the birthplace of this radio station, which has become the leading independent network of local radio stations, with 64 stations in France and Belgium (270 FM frequencies and 95 DAB+ transmitters), attracting no fewer than 600,000 listeners every day! A local Christian radio station, open to the world and to others, offering a different voice that brings joy and hope. Discoveries, dialogue and exchanges, current affairs, music and times for spiritual reflection: RCF is the Christian radio for loving the world. RCF Haute-Savoie organizes numerous round-table discussions on a variety of subjects of interest to all audiences.

Its story began on the slopes of Lyon in 1982, when Father Emmanuel Payen set up the antenna of France's first free Christian radio station in the attics of the Fourvière basilica. Fourvière became RCF for Radios Chrétiennes de France, then Radios Chrétiennes Francophones, and has continued to expand its airwaves, giving rise to France's leading associative network. The local RCF Drôme station organizes round-table discussions on subjects of interest to more than just Catholics, and publishes a regional news bulletin.
